About The Position

Essential Duties and Responsibilities: Learn and develop an understanding of the personal lines marketplace. Under supervision, analyze and underwrite new business for a select group of agents and senior underwriters. Rate policies efficiently, accurately, and within the guidelines of the available program(s) Promptly address inquiries from agents, policyholder, or prospects. Evaluate policies for renewal consideration and recommend appropriate price or coverage adjustments based on prior policy experience. Participate in phone and email marketing communication of our products and services to our clients. Develop relationships with our existing clients as well as establish new relationships Attend on-site marketing visits with underwriting team Handle Follow-Ups as assigned Perform other duties as assigned.

Requirements

  • Must have a valid Producer’s License.
  • 3 or more years of insurance experience is required.
  • Demonstrated experience in standard underwriting practices and procedures is strongly preferred.
  • Must possess effective communication, negotiation, and computer skills.
  • Must possess strong analytical skills and detail orientation.
  • Comprehensive knowledge of insurance coverage forms and their application to exposure strongly preferred.
  • Working knowledge of applicable Insurance Department regulations and policies is required.
  • Ability to work independently and to carry out assignments to completion within parameters of instructions given, prescribed routines and standard accepted underwriting practices is required.
